How do I calculate the heat exchanger duty for storage tanks? Is it enough to calculate the heat loss from the tank for this purpose?

1 December 2009 at 1:29pmThe calculation of heat gain/loss from a storage tank must include all environmental conditions such as solar radiation, wind, extremes of temperature and precipitation before a heat exchanger can be designed to maintain a temperature control point. One should also consider the feed to the storage tank and whether that provides a larger load than the environmental conditions.
